Output bc188c7813bf06d2e9f0caf1b12dcda6254e4d622a004b4f5e225332c10891e6:6

value
2491609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8132d968105d6b448085a09dd9a98f5ec085a325 OP_EQUAL
address
3DUA1MgD6SFHQkEwVbwAUTQFiAU9kPdjeE
transaction
bc188c7813bf06d2e9f0caf1b12dcda6254e4d622a004b4f5e225332c10891e6
spent
true